And he had prepared for him a great chamber, where aforetime they laid the meat offerings, the frankincense, and the vessels, and the tithes of the corn, the new wine, and the oil, which was commanded [to be given] to the Levites, and the singers, and the porters; and the offerings of the priests.
Complete Jewish Bible:
had prepared for him a large room where formerly they had stored the grain offerings, frankincense, equipment and the tenths of grain, wine and olive oil ordered to be given to the L'vi'im, singers and gatekeepers, and the contributions for the cohanim.
Berean Standard Bible:
and had prepared for Tobiah a large room where they had previously stored the grain offerings, the frankincense, the temple articles, and the tithes of grain, new wine, and oil prescribed for the Levites, singers, and gatekeepers, along with the contributions for the priests.
American Standard Version:
had prepared for him a great chamber, where aforetime they laid the meal-offerings, the frankincense, and the vessels, and the tithes of the grain, the new wine, and the oil, which were given by commandment to the Levites, and the singers, and the porters; and the heave-offerings for the priests.

Strong's Number: H3957 There are 41 instances of this translation in the Bible Lemma: לִשְׁכָּה Transliteration: lishkâh Pronunciation: lish-kaw' Description: from an unused root of uncertain meaning; a room in a building (whether for storage, eating, or lodging); chamber, parlour. Compare נִשְׁכָּה.

Strong's Number: H4503 There are 194 instances of this translation in the Bible Lemma: מִנְחָה Transliteration: minchâh Pronunciation: min-khaw' Description: from an unused root meaning to apportion, i.e. bestow; a donation; euphemistically, tribute; specifically a sacrificial offering (usually bloodless and voluntary); gift, oblation, (meat) offering, present, sacrifice.
Strong's Number: H3828 There are 21 instances of this translation in the Bible Lemma: לְבוֹנָה Transliteration: lᵉbôwnâh Pronunciation: leb-o-naw' Description: or לְבֹנָה; from לָבָן; frankincense (from its whiteness or perhaps that of its smoke); (frank-) incense.

Strong's Number: H4643 There are 27 instances of this translation in the Bible Lemma: מַעֲשֵׂר Transliteration: maʻăsêr Pronunciation: mah-as-ayr' Description: or מַעֲשַׂר; and (in plural) feminine מַעַשְׂרָה; from עָשָׂר; a tenth; especially a tithe; tenth (part), tithe(-ing).
Strong's Number: H1715 There are 40 instances of this translation in the Bible Lemma: דָּגָן Transliteration: dâgân Pronunciation: daw-gawn' Description: from דָּגָה; properly, increase, i.e. grain; corn (floor), wheat.
Strong's Number: H8492 There are 38 instances of this translation in the Bible Lemma: תִּירוֹשׁ Transliteration: tîyrôwsh Pronunciation: tee-roshe' Description: or תִּירֹשׁ; from יָרַשׁ in the sense of expulsion; must or fresh grape-juice (as just squeezed out); by implication (rarely) fermented wine; (new, sweet) wine.
Strong's Number: H3323 There are 23 instances of this translation in the Bible Lemma: יִצְהָר Transliteration: yitshâr Pronunciation: yits-hawr' Description: from צָהַר; oil (as producing light); figuratively, anointing; [phrase] anointed oil.
Strong's Number: H4687 There are 177 instances of this translation in the Bible Lemma: מִצְוָה Transliteration: mitsvâh Pronunciation: mits-vaw' Description: from צָוָה; a command, whether human or divine (collectively, the Law); (which was) commanded(-ment), law, ordinance, precept.
Strong's Number: H3881 There are 258 instances of this translation in the Bible Lemma: לֵוִיִּי Transliteration: Lêvîyîy Pronunciation: lay-vee-ee' Description: or לֵוִי; patronymically from לֵוִי; a Levite or descendant of Levi; Leviite.
Strong's Number: H7891 There are 79 instances of this translation in the Bible Lemma: שִׁיר Transliteration: shîyr Pronunciation: sheer Description: or (the original form) שׁוּר; (1 Samuel 18:6), a primitive root (rather identical with שׁוּר through the idea of strolling minstrelsy); to sing; behold (by mistake for שׁוּר), sing(-er, -ing man, -ing woman).
Strong's Number: H7778 There are 37 instances of this translation in the Bible Lemma: שׁוֹעֵר Transliteration: shôwʻêr Pronunciation: sho-are' Description: or שֹׁעֵר active participle of שָׁעַר (as denominative from שַׁעַר); a janitor; doorkeeper, porter.
Strong's Number: H8641 There are 63 instances of this translation in the Bible Lemma: תְּרוּמָה Transliteration: tᵉrûwmâh Pronunciation: ter-oo-maw' Description: or תְּרֻמָה; (Deuteronomy 12:11), from רוּם; a present (as offered up), especially in sacrifice or as tribute; gift, heave offering (shoulder), oblation, offered(-ing).
Strong's Number: H3548 There are 653 instances of this translation in the Bible Lemma: כֹּהֵן Transliteration: kôhên Pronunciation: ko-hane' Description: active participle of כָּהַן; literally one officiating, a priest; also (by courtesy) an acting priest (although a layman); chief ruler, [idiom] own, priest, prince, principal officer.
